GE Pro afile Opal 2.0 Nugget Ice Maker is designed to provide chewable, crunchy nugget ice quickly and efficiently. This manual provides essential information for the safe and effective operation, maintenance, and troubleshooting of your ice maker.
The Opal 2.0 produces approximately 1.6 pounds of fresh ice per hour, with a total capacity of 3 pounds in its ice bin. It features a 0.75-gallon side tank for extended operation and smart connectivity via Wi-Fi for convenient control and monitoring.

Enstalasyon tank dlo
The Opal 2.0 comes with a side tank to increase water capacity and reduce refill frequency.
- Ensure the main unit's water reservoir is empty.
- Fill the side tank with potable water.
- Attach the side tank to the main unit, ensuring the connection is secure and the tubes lie flat to allow proper water flow.

Antretyen
Regular cleaning and descaling are crucial for optimal performance and ice quality.
Netwayaj
Clean the ice maker at least once per week. This includes wiping down the exterior, interior, and ice bin.

Image: A hand wiping the top surface of the GE Profile Opal Ice Maker with a blue cloth, reminding users to clean weekly and descale every 2-3 weeks for best results.
Detartraj
Descale your Opal ice maker monthly, or more frequently (every 2-3 weeks) if you live in an area with hard water. Hard water can significantly impact the ice maker's performance.

Depanaj
Gade seksyon sa a pou pwoblèm komen ak solisyon yo.
| Pwoblèm | Kòz posib | Solisyon |
|---|---|---|
| Unit alerts to add water when reservoir is full (blue light ring switching). | Inadequate water flow or air in water lines. | Follow descaling procedure (manual page 9). For air in lines, remove water filter, press finger at reservoir outlet 4 times in a rapid plunger-like movement to force water into lines. |
| Low ice quantity or unit continuously enters defrost (white light ring slowly falling). | Inadequate cooling or improper spacing around the unit. | With the unit off, use a vacuum to clean the vent on the left side to remove dust/debris. Ensure a minimum of 3 inches of clearance around the sides and back for proper air circulation. |
| Hard water stains in reservoir/back wall/ice bin. | Akimilasyon mineral ki soti nan dlo di. | Perform the descaling procedure (manual page 9). Regular descaling is essential. |
